Who is right?

 

We at Cornerstone are very aware of the many voices and claims which are made by many religions and cults and the tremendous confusion caused by the great variations in belief. Much of this is caused by accepting some other authority over the Bible, God's Holy Word. There are those who believe that an understanding of the Bible is incomplete and useless apart from the writings and teaching of their organization. Other lay tradition, opinion, etc. on the same level as God 's Word; while still others, in frustration, hold that the Bible cannot clearly be known.
But God is not the author of such confusion and the Bible clearly lays out the word, workings, and will of God. Its best interpretation is that which comes from its own pages without the bias of man being added to it. However, its truths are to be believed, and given a place above any teachings which find their source in man, no matter how well intended. For this reason , we hold the Word of God as sole and final authority concerning all matters of truth and belief. We willingly submit to its teachings which come through its careful study and by "rightly dividing the Word of truth"! 2 Timothy 2:15

FIRST: "How Are We Saved?" Many religious and non-religious views teach basically the same thing.....either we are saved by our good outweighing our bad -or- they conclude that God is too loving to condemn anyone to Hell. Both of these conclusions are unfounded and in conflict with what God's Word, the Bible teaches!

The Bible tells us that.......
(1) Man is a sinner incapable of saving himself - Romans 3:10-23
(2) Man's works, no matter how good, cannot save him - Titus 3:5;
Romans 3:20,28; Galatians 2:16,21; 3:21
(3) God provided for our salvation through grace because of
the shed blood of His Son - Romans 3:24,25; Ephesians 1:7; 2:
8,9; 1 Peter 1:18,19. Jesus died in YOUR PLACE (substitution) because of YOUR SIN (sacrifice) - 2 Corinthians 5:21; 1 Peter 2:
24
(4) Only through believing and receiving Jesus alone into our
life, through repentance, can we be saved. There is NO OTHER WAY! - John 1:12; 3:16,36; 14:6; Acts 4:12; Romans 10:9,10
(5) NOW is the time to ask God to forgive us of our sin and become our personal Savior.....TOMORROW MAY BE TOO
LATE!! 2 Corinthians 6:2

It is essential to believe what God has said in His Word concerning "How Are We Saved"! Any other way, no matter how sincere, is the WRONG WAY and will lead to eternal damnation! Romans 10:17; Proverbs 14:12; Matthew 7:13,14

SECOND: "Where Will I Spend Eternity When I Die?" The answer to this question has everything to do with your answer to the first question! If you are saved by the grace of God, you will spend eternity in Heaven with God. However, if you choose to disregard God's provision for your salvation through the Lord Jesus Christ as the only way of salvation and reject this gift of eternal life freely, you will be lost forever in Hell!
Now there are those who do not believe in either a Heaven or Hell as future destinations for all of mankind but say that they are here on earth. Others teach that there will be annihilation of the soul and spirit upon physical death and we will become non-existent.
That is NOT what the Bible teaches.......
(1) There is an eternal consciousness and life beyond the grave - Hebrews 9:27
(2) HELL is the final destination for all those who have rejected
Christ (Luke 16:19-31) and HEAVEN for all those who have placed their trust in Christ alone for their salvation (John 14:1-3;
2 Corinthians 5:1-8)
(3) Those who never receive Jesus Christ as their personal Savior, when they die...will have part in the "resurrection unto damnation" (John 5:28,29); will appear before the Great White Throne Judgment Seat of Christ to be condemned according to their works because of their unbelief (John 3:16-18; Revelation 20:11,12) and will be cast into the Lake of Fire forever to be eternally punished and separated from God (Revelation 20:13-15; Matthew 22:13; Mark 9:43-48; 2 Thessalonians 1:7-10)
(4) Those who have trusted Jesus Christ alone for the forgiveness of their sin...will have ETERNAL LIFE and never be condemned for their sin (John 5:24; Romans 8:1); will have part in the "resurrection unto life" (John 5:28,29; 1 Corinthians 15:51-58; 1 Thessalonians 4:13-18; Revelations 20:6); and HEAVEN will be their eternal home (1 Peter 1:3-5; Philippians 3:20,21; Colossians 1:3-6)
